OREANDA-NEWS. July 30, 2013. "The consumption of natural gas by boiler should be reduced to ensure stable heat tariffs for households. Therefore, the Government pays special attention to the introduction of new technologies in housing and utility sector," vice Prime Minister Olexandr Vilkul said in Donetsk during a working meeting on the modernization of district heating systems.

"A positive example is the experience of boiler of DonetskMiskTeploMerezha MCE in Ionin Street, where a cogeneration unit is installed. As a result, the boiler in winter will be able to provide itself with electricity, and to provide with electricity other three boilers of the company in summer," Olexandr Vilkul said.

Due to the fact that the cogeneration unit can simultaneously produce heat and electricity," DonetskMiskTeploMerezha MCE will purchase electricity less.

"The economic impact of this project is over UAH 5 million per year. Thus, the savings will be used to further modernization of the enterprise that will improve the quality of public services," vice Prime Minister said.

In 2012, 7 cogeneration technology installation projects were implemented in the Autonomous Republic of Crimea (1 project), in Donetsk region (3 projects), in Dnipropetrovsk region (1 project) in Odessa region (1 project) and in Kyiv (1 project).
